Wagering requirements are the single biggest factor in whether a bonus is worth claiming. These are set by each operator and commonly fall between 20x and 65x, though the exact figure varies by offer. As a worked example, a £50 bonus at 35x wagering means you must stake £1,750 before any winnings become withdrawable. That is a substantial commitment, so check the figure before you click claim. A lower wagering requirement can make a smaller bonus more valuable than a larger one with punishing terms, so do the maths before you get excited about a headline number.
